Simple math / physics (where's pattar?).

More weight and mass going through the ball, less deflection, even though we're only talking an ounce! Get her into the heaviest bat she can handle now.

Is she playing rec ball or travel ball? If she's playing rec ball, are they using RIF balls? If they are, the performance advantages of a top-shelf bat are pretty much wiped out by a squishy RIF ball. If they aren't using RIF balls, then go for a good bat, if you want to spend the money.

In reality, all of the top-shelf bats are pretty similar in performance. If your DD's swing is pretty flawed, sorting out her swing will help her a LOT more than a top-shelf bat.
